Napoli have reportedly agreed a deal with Andrea Belotti, and are prepared to offer €50m to Torino.

The striker has a €100m release clause in his contract for foreign clubs, but after an injury hit 2017-18 his value has dropped.

According to SportItalia, an agreement has been struck between the Partenopei and Il Gallo’s entourage on a five-year contract worth €3.5m per season.

Belotti himself would be open to the move, but Torino are asking for €65m to sell their prize asset.

Napoli are only willing to offer €50m, but an agreement could be possible at around €60m.

The Granata may well stick to their guns, but that would mean offering the striker a big hike to his current salary.
